In the small city of Martinsville, Virginia, there is a pastor who validates the Apostle Paul's decree of "I can do all things through Christ which strengtheneth me." Bishop Michael Penn, better known as "Pastor Penn" is married to Angela Kidd Penn and is the father of 3 children; Jonathan, Sean and Candice. He also has two grandchildren, Havyn and Jaxon.

In the year 2000, Pastor Penn began this journey of destiny when he was appointed Senior Pastor of Galilee Missionary Baptist Church which is now known as The Galilean House of Worship (The GHOW). Pastor Penn has also been divinely appointed to be one of the spiritual gatekeepers for Martinsville and Henry County, a rural area with a population of about 15,000 people. When he started pastoring, the church had about 200 members and the church has grown to over 1500 members. God has placed in his heart to teach the body of Christ for the last days. He has also been called to teach and preach to the nations.

In addition to his role as Senior Pastor of The Galilean House of Worship, Pastor Penn established Michael Penn Ministries International and The League of Independent Ministers (L.I.M.) in 2006. L.I.M. was birthed based on Hebrews 6:12, "That ye be not slothful, but followers of them who through faith and patience inherit the promises." L.I.M. is a mentorship that provides access to resources and positive guidance, direction, support and motivation for pastors, and helps ministers and churches get to the next level. Since its conception, apostles, bishops, elders, and ministers have been joining from all across the United States and has grown to well over 100 members. L.I.M. is an awesome fellowship that allows God's leaders from all denominations to network, share, learn and grow together without having to leave their own churches or beliefs.

Pastor Penn has established The Galilean House of Worship (The GHOW) as a word based, non-denominational church. A theme verse for the church is Matthew 5:16, "Let your light so shine before men, that they may see your good works, and glorify your Father which is in heaven." Pastor Penn speaks his heart in saying "We want to be a place to give people hope." He describes The GHOW as a WASH house, W-Worship, A-Army, S-School, and H-Hospital. He has a strong desire for the spiritual growth of people and excellence in ministry. In 2009, Pastor Penn and The Galilean church family marched into a new 43-acre site which includes a 60,000 square feet state of the art church facility which is Phase I of the vision. Phase II began to take shape in 2012 and uses existing land in the rear of the church to construct a park, walking trail and amphitheater. Phase III will include a plaza with a fellowship hall, gym, bookstore and restaurant. Phase IV will utilize an additional 23-acre site for leadership training and for a retreat/half way house which will provide bunk housing for those in need of short-term habitation.
